Dr Gary Tincknell is a Medical Oncologist, a cancer specialist, based at Cancer Care Wollongong in Wollongong, New South Wales. He works at 410 Crown Street, Wollongong NSW 2500, and you can reach the clinic by phone at 0242273733. He focuses on cancer care and uses treatments like chemotherapy to help people in the Illawarra region.
Dr Tincknell’s clinic, Cancer Care Wollongong, offers cancer screenings, chemotherapy, palliative care, and symptom management.
